Did They Go up Much or Little? so They Moved the Prices of Four Fast Food Star Combos in Costa Rica in the Last Year

Over the past year, Costa Rica has experienced a clear trend of deflation, with year-on-year inflation reaching -1.0 per cent in September 2025, after five consecutive months of price falls. INEC official data show that the cumulative variation in the Consumer Price Index between January and September 2025 was -1.95%, reflecting a sustained decline in prices of basic goods and services during this period.
